Telematics

JDLink is a telematics solution that collects machine information and

transfers it to your computer or mobile device. JDLink Select can be

installed on all makes while JDLink Ultimate is available on John Deere

machines.

What information can JDLink Ultimate offer the customer?

– Alerts (DTC, maintenance, curfew, geofence)

– Machine Utilization Data

– Machine Location

– Machine Hours

– Maintenance Items

– Security

– Remote Service Support

Auto Mode v. Manual Mode Operating Costs

• Supplement the value of monitoring auto v. manual mode in JDLink with Nebraska Tractor Test Lab Reports

Page 11: Beyond precision agriculture:Emerging technologies

|Beyond Precision Ag – Emerging Technologies | January 2013!11

Auto v. Manual Mode Operating Costs

1. Determine lb/hr • Manual Mode: 0.521 lb/hp - hr * 148.68 hp = 77.462 lb/hr • Auto Mode: 0.445 lb/hp - hr * 148.63 hp = 66.140 lb/hr

2. Determine gal/hr used • M: 77.462 lb/hr /(1/7.075 lb/gal= 0.141 gal/lb) = 10.922 gal/hr • A: 66.140 lb/hr /(1/7.075 lb/gal= 0.141 gal/lb) = 9.326 gal/hr

3. Determine fuel used per season • M: 10.922 gal/hr * 160 hr = 1747.520 gal • A: 9.326 gal/hr * 160 hr = 1492.160 gal

4. Determine cost savings by using auto mode • M: 1747.520 gal * $4.00/gal = $6990.08 • A: 1492.160 gal * $4.00/gal = $5968.64 • Used Arbitrary Fuel Price/Gal

Little

differences like

manual mode

v. auto mode

can make big

differences like

this

Cost Savings for

Season: $1021.44

Nebraska OECD Tractor Test 1991 Report for John Deere 8360R – IVT Tractor Information: Fuel Weight: 7.075 lb/gal Fuel Consumption

50% Max Pull at Maximum Power – Manual Mode:0.521 lb/hp-hr 50% Max Pull at Reduced Engine Speed – Auto Mode: 0.445 lb/hp-hr

Taking Away Unnecessary Hours from Warranty

Scenario

Customer owns a 8360R in his custom fleet of tractors. On average the tractor runs for 1250 hours annually, and approximately 30% (375) of those are idle time hours. The customer notices at the end of the second year, that the tractor’s warranty* will be up in 500 hours and he needs to think about trading it in soon.

*8360R’s warranty is PowerGard 3-3-x, 3 years or 3000 hours, whichever comes first.

Page 13: Beyond precision agriculture:Emerging technologies

|Beyond Precision Ag – Emerging Technologies | January 2013!13

Taking Away Unnecessary Hours from Warranty

If the customer would have reduced idle time by 10%:

3000 hrs x 30% = 900 hours in idle

3000 hrs x 20% = 600 hours in idle

Customer would add 300 more working hours to warranty rather than using up that warranty time in idle mode.

Consideration: How much more profit could that customer gain from having that machine use 300 more working hours?

Remote Support Machine Optimization

Remote Display Access

– Telematics also enables remote access to displays in the cab

– Remote access is useful for supporting setup in the field or

troubleshooting an issue

– The farm manager can offer remote support to their operator

– The dealership can provide remote support to the operator with

their permission

Machine Control Logistics Optimization

Guidance Technology

– Automatic machine guidance is

well established in the Ag

Industry

– With more advanced technology,

remote control options are now

available

– These tools are reducing operator

stress and increasing productivity

– Machine Sync is a tool that allows

the combine operator to control

the location of the grain cart

– Machine to machine

communication also provides bin

level to the grain cart operator

Ag Decision Support

Water management

– Water is key for successful crop

production

– Technology has allowed producers to

monitor soil moisture levels and make

more informed decisions

– Irrigation can be managed

– Plants can be stressed at the proper

time

– John Deere Field Connect is one

product that measures and records soil

moisture level data that can be

accessed over the internet
